Many people with type 2 diabetes and prediabetes automatically think that following a gluten-free diet is going to help their blood sugar levels. While it certainly can, unfortunately it’s not in the way people think. For instance, many gluten-free foods are high in carbohydrates and low in nutritional quality.

That may be confusing since it comes from a legume that is traditionally not allowed on keto, low-carb, or paleo diets. The reason that it is keto-friendly is that the lupini bean is high fiber, high protein, and low-carb legume. ¼ CUP OF LUPIN FLOUR days to maturity oregano
